OBD Guide

P1661

MIL Control Circuit Conditions

P1661 is an OBD-II diagnostic trouble code meaning: MIL Control Circuit Conditions. Common causes: open or short circuit in mil control circuit, engine control module (ecm) malfunction. Estimated repair cost: $6–56.

Severity
⚠️ Medium
Can you drive?
Yes, but get it checked soon
Approx. repair cost
$6–56 (est.)

Symptoms

  • Check engine light does not come on when starting
  • The check engine light is constantly on
  • Check engine light flashes
  • Unable to read fault codes

Causes

  • Open or short circuit in MIL control circuit
  • Engine control module (ECM) malfunction
  • Problems with connectors or wiring
  • MIL lamp failure
  • Power or grounding problems

How to Fix

  1. Check the integrity of wiring and connectors in the MIL circuit
  2. Check the MIL lamp on the instrument panel
  3. Check MIL circuit power and ground
  4. Flash or replace engine control module (ECM)

Related codes

Error P1661 by Vehicle Brand

FAQ

What does the P1661 code mean?

P1661 is an OBD-II diagnostic trouble code that indicates: MIL Control Circuit Conditions

What causes a P1661 error code?

The most common causes of P1661 include: Open or short circuit in MIL control circuit; Engine control module (ECM) malfunction; Problems with connectors or wiring; MIL lamp failure.

How do I fix a P1661 diagnostic trouble code?

To fix P1661: Check the integrity of wiring and connectors in the MIL circuit. Check the MIL lamp on the instrument panel. Check MIL circuit power and ground. For a complete diagnosis, use an OBD-II scanner.

Is it safe to drive with P1661?

Yes, but get it checked soon

How much does it cost to fix P1661?

The estimated repair cost for P1661 is $6–56. Actual cost depends on your vehicle, location, and labor rates.

See also: Russian version · NationStat